Rear-end damage on an EV is a structural question first

The visible damage was a crease running through the rear quarter panel, a dented trunk lid, a taillight pushed out of its opening, and a bumper cover torn loose and hanging. On any sedan that combination means the impact reached the rear body panel and the closing structure behind the cover. On an electric car it also means the area around the battery enclosure and the rear drive unit has to be inspected before anything is straightened.

That is the real difference between repairing a Model 3 and repairing a gasoline sedan. The floor is a structural battery pack, the rear of the car carries high-voltage cabling, and manufacturer procedure decides what may be pulled, heated, or welded near any of it. A shop that skips those procedures can hand back a car that looks perfect and is no longer the car it was. The procedures for this vehicle are published and specific, and following them is most of the job on an electric car — the sheet metal work is the part any competent shop already knows.

How the repair was carried out

The sequence on this car was set by the vehicle rather than by convenience. High voltage down first, then teardown, then measurement, then structural correction, then panels, then paint, then reassembly and a full systems check. Nothing was ordered until the back of the car had been opened up and photographed, because the crush on a rear hit hides in the trunk floor where the spare well and the rear rails sit.

Tesla body panels are also unusually unforgiving of a bad match. Their reds are deep multi-coat finishes that shift with the light, so the trunk lid, quarter panel, and bumper cover all have to agree with each other in daylight and not only under booth lighting. Color was mixed from the paint code, verified on a card, and blended out across the panels either side of the repair.

  • High-voltage system shut down and verified before any teardown at the rear
  • Bumper cover, taillight, and trim removed to expose the rear structure
  • Rear body structure laser-measured against factory specification
  • Quarter panel worked back to shape; parts beyond safe repair replaced
  • Multi-coat red mixed from the paint code and blended into adjacent panels
  • Rear-facing cameras, sensors, and lighting checked before the car was released

What to look for in a repaired Tesla

Start at the trunk. The lid should close with one hand and sit level with the quarter panels on both sides, and the gaps around it should stay parallel from the taillights to the roofline. Then run a hand along the quarter panel where the crease was: the surface should feel like a single continuous curve, with no low spot where filler was feathered out to hide one.

Next, look at the car outdoors at an angle rather than head-on. Multi-coat reds hide their sins under fluorescent light and expose them in the sun, which is where a lazy match turns pink or dark against the panel beside it. Finally, ask what was done about the electronics — rear cameras, park sensors, and lighting all live in the area that was hit, and none of them are optional.

Can an independent body shop repair a Tesla?

Yes. Tesla does not have to perform collision work on its own cars, and in Minnesota the choice of shop is yours regardless of what your insurance company or the vehicle manufacturer suggests. What matters is that the shop follows the published repair procedures, handles the high-voltage system correctly, and does not improvise around the battery structure.

Is the battery a concern in a rear-end collision?

It is a consideration in every EV repair, even when the pack itself is untouched. The pack forms part of the floor structure, so the way the rear of the car is pulled and measured has to respect it, and the high-voltage system stays shut down for the duration of the work. Any sign of intrusion into the enclosure changes the repair plan entirely.

Do EV repairs take longer than repairs on a gasoline car?

They can. Shutdown and reactivation procedures, parts availability, and post-repair systems checks all add steps a gasoline sedan does not have. Your written estimate includes a timeline that accounts for those steps, and we tell you as soon as teardown changes it rather than letting the date slide quietly.
